Are there specific regulations for junkyards in Homosassa, Florida?expand_more

Yes, Citrus County has specific zoning and environmental regulations that junkyards must follow. These regulations often cover things like proper storage of fluids and waste, as well as fencing and visual screening. It's designed to protect the natural beauty of the area and the Homosassa River.

Do Homosassa junkyards typically offer warranties on used auto parts?expand_more

Warranty policies vary widely among junkyards in Homosassa and Citrus County. Some yards may offer a limited warranty or exchange policy, while others sell parts 'as is.' It's crucial to ask about warranty options before you make a purchase so you know what recourse you have if a part fails soon after installation.
